Scope and Content This shows the mid-19th-century, three-storeyed tenement at 154-166 Canongate. This tenement has shops at ground-floor level, and a central arched pend which leads to Sugarhouse Close to the rear. This central bay has a two-storeyed oriel window at first and second floor which projects on stone brackets above the central pend. The crowstepped gable above is topped with a star-shaped finial. The Victorian timber shop fronts are relatively unaltered, and the tenement has retained its original eight- and 12-paned timber sash and case windows throughout.
